WIRELESS HEADSETS
The headset is a rugged, water-resistant dual-channel all-in-one headset that operates in the ISM
license-free 5 GHz frequency range� The all-in-one headset has an ergonomic design with tactile
touch keys, level controls, and end of the boom talk indication LED�
The all-in-one headset connects to Equip Base via the transceivers, (Region specific). all-in-one
headset users can roam seamlessly between transceivers over wide areas� The all-in-one headset
uses one rechargeable lithium-ion battery� With moderate use in a typical environment� The head-
set will operate for approximately eight hours on a single battery charge� It will alert you when the
battery charge is low�

HEADSET PARING
Pair the headset by holding the headset’s keypad side against the Headset Pairing Ring (solid blue
circle) on the base station� Pairing begins automatically as soon as the headset is sensed�
When the Headset Pairing Ring turns solid green, pairing is successful� The Headset status LED also
turns solid green� See Fig� 30� Also see "Quick Start Guide" for more details on using the EQUIP

Note:
If pairing fails (indicated by a red swirling ring), try again� Hold the headset steadily cen-
tered and flush against the headset pairing ring (movement and distance from the pairing ring can
cause pairing errors)�
